If you ever face a similar situation, a few practical steps can save time and stress. First, check if your key fob has a hidden physical key—many modern remotes include one that manually unlocks the door. Once inside, some cars allow you to start the engine by holding the fob close to the start button, even if the battery is weak. Replacing the battery is often quick and inexpensive. Having a backup plan—like a spare key or roadside assistance—also helps.
